
David Allen is currently the Dean of the School of Theology at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ary where he also serves as Professor of Preaching, Director of the Center for Expository Preaching, and the George W. Truett Chair of Ministry. He holds a Bachelor of Arts from Criswell College, a Master of Divinity from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ary, and a Doctorate in Humanities from the University of Texas at Arlington.

Mac Brunson is the Senior Pastor of First Baptist Church in Jacksonville, Florida. He holds a Bachelor of Arts from Furman University, a Master of Divinity and Doctorate of Ministry from The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ary, and an honorary Doctorate of Divinity from Dallas Baptist University.

Junior Hill is an Evangelist and Founder of Junior Hill Ministries. He graduated from Samford University and received a Master of Divinity from New Orleans Baptist Theological Seminary. In 2000 he was awarded a Doctorate of Divinity degree by Liberty University.

Johnny Hunt is currently the Pastor of First Baptist Church in Woodstock, Georgia. He holds a Bachelor of Arts in Religion from Gardner-Webb College and a Master of Divinity from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ary. He has received a Doctorate of Divinity from Immanual Baptist Theological Seminary and a Doctorate of Sacred Laws and Letters from Covington Theological Seminary.

Al Mohler is the ninth President of The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ary. He holds a Bachelor of Arts from Samford University and a Master of Divinity and a Doctorate of Philosophy from The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ary. He has pursued additional study at the St. Meinrad School of Theology and has conducted research at Oxford University (England) Seminary.

Tommy Nelson is the Senior Pastor at Denton Bible Church in Denton, Texas. He teaches three Men’s Bible Studies and also travels around the United States ten times a year teaching the nationally known Song of Solomon Conferences and serves on the Dallas Theological Seminary Board of Incorporate Members.

Paige Patterson is the eighth President of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ary. He graduated from Hardin-Simmons University and completed a Master of Theology and a Doctorate of Theology at New Orleans Baptist Theological Seminary.

Jerry Vines has been a Baptist Pastor for over 50 years. The last 23 years, he served as Pastor at First Baptist Church of Jacksonville, Florida, before his retirement in February 2006. He began the Pastors’ Conference while at FBC Jax and celebrated the 20th anniversary of the conference at the time of his retirement. He now serves pastors all over the country and offers many resources through Jerry Vines Ministries.
